Heavy Vintage D & D Clark Navajo Sterling Silver Turquoise Cuff Bracelet 153g

 

This broad bangle Navajo cuff bracelet features decorative applied sterling silver leaves, scrolls, dewdrops and small flowers on heavy gauge sterling band. The bracelet is open to the back and has rounded chiselled contoured edges. There are five ovoid claw bezels set with beautiful rough polished pieces of natural Kingman turquoise.

 

It is unmarked; tests confirm it to be 925 for its sterling silver fineness. The rear is stamped with two “D” initials spaced apart for its maker’s Donny & Dorothy Clark (Navajo).

It is in excellent pre-loved condition with no damage or faults to report, some expected light wear and a warm patina. The photos are part of the description and condition report.

 

Measures: top width 6.15cm x H1cm, rear width 6.15cm, 18.4cm inner circumference; weighs 153.1g overall.
